    putting up a feeler thread for my wheels. u dont see many bmw's running these wheels if at all at this point. they are ze forged mesh wheels 2-piece. offsets are unknown but i believe they are 8/40et by 10/25et. the fitment is very conservative in the front (pics are with 18mm spacers) but the rears are very aggressive with a 4 inch lip and pokin on a non-m sedan.

    these wheels are a work in progress. i purchased them pretty beat up and have them chemically stripped so the finish is metal. lips were then lightly polished but do need some work to make them shine and pop. one front wheel was repaired and i dont experience any shaking but if u want peace of mind i have been quoted 40 bucks to have it fixed to look brand new (inside of wheel). curb rash on some of the wheels but nothing major.












    im running falken 452's 215/35/19 by 235/35/19 without about 1500 miles that im willing to sell along with the wheels if the buyer requests them. these wheels go for about 3400 for the set brand new along with the tires that cost me 600. i would estimate no more than 400 dollars to have these wheels looking brand spanking new. my prices are set at 2300 for the wheels and tires or 1900 for the wheels alone. included will be the polished caps and extra rivets. im in no rush to sell, if anything ill just have these refinished myself
